She was predeceased by: her brother Larry Churchill. She is survived by: her husband Joe; her children, Kenneth Reichert (Crystal) of Roland, OK. and Phyllis Parker (Scott) of Greenbrier, AR; her stepchildren, Carl McPeak (Angel) of Morrilton, AR, Tawnya Shelton (Shawn) of Alma, AR and Tammy McCause (Danny) of Bella Vista, AR.; her siblings, Lowell Churchill, Jr. (Kaylene) of Oklahoma City, OK and Dinah Churchill of Muldrow, OK.; and her grandchildren, Kyle (Cody Reichert), Zach, Garrett (Alisa McPeak), Josh, Allison (Christian), DaKota (Tanner Shelton) and Hannah (Haven McCause).
